The Business Analyst will play a central role in establishing and growing a new Business Analysis practice, helping to define not just solutions, but also the standards, frameworks, and ways of working that underpin how we deliver. Sitting between business stakeholders and technology teams, you will lead the translation of complex business needs into clear, actionable requirements, ensuring delivery is aligned to strategic objectives and measurable outcomes. As the practice develops, you will also contribute to shaping BA governance, tooling, and best‑practice approaches across Agile and Waterfall environments. Within public sector programmes, you will operate in complex, highly governed environments, often engaging with senior stakeholders, policy teams, and third‑party suppliers. This includes navigating regulatory and compliance requirements, procurement frameworks, and ensuring solutions are secure, accessible, and deliver value for money. You will play a key role in ensuring delivery aligns not only to project goals, but also to wider organisational and societal outcomes. As the practice grows, you will also support the development of junior Business Analysts, helping to mentor, coach, and embed consistent standards of analysis and delivery excellence across the team. Through strong analysis, communication, and leadership, you will help shape a high‑performing BA function that enables successful delivery across complex programmes of work.

A day in the life

A typical day may involve facilitating discussions with business stakeholders to explore requirements or clarify priorities, then working with technology teams to translate those needs into user stories or functional specifications. You might review documentation, refine scope or timelines with delivery leads, or support agile ceremonies such as sprint planning or reviews. Alongside this, you may be analysing processes, identifying risks or dependencies, and working through mitigation options with the team. Throughout the day, you balance detail‑oriented analysis with stakeholder communication, ensuring everyone has a shared understanding of what is being delivered and why.
